With most seniors out of the workforce and living on fixed incomes or retirement savings, the rapidly rising cost of living has put a financial strain on older households.

Beyond inflation, however, seniors need more money than ever to live comfortably in retirement. The life expectancy of a 65-year-old in the U.S. has risen by more than four years since 1970.

Seniors also face greater health issues than the rest of the population, which comes at a high cost. The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services estimate that per-capita health care spending for seniors is nearly three times as high as that for the working-age population.

Faced with these circumstances, older Americans are staying in the workforce longer.

To determine the best-paying locations for working seniors, researchers at Smartest Dollar calculated the cost-of-living adjusted median annual wage for seniors working full-time. The data used in this analysis is from the U.S. Census Bureau.

For the purposes of this analysis, seniors were considered to be age 65 and older. Find details on our methodology at the end.

Here are the best-paying U.S. metropolitan areas for working seniors.

15. Oklahoma City, OK

  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(adjusted): $60,372
  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(actual): $56,000
  • Median annual wage for all full-time workers (adjusted): $50,669
  • Share of full-time workforce that are seniors: 3.8%
  • Share of population that are seniors: 14.8%

14. Cincinnati, OH-KY-IN

  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(adjusted): $60,418
  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(actual): $57,000
  • Median annual wage for all full-time workers (adjusted): $58,298
  • Share of full-time workforce that are seniors: 3.8%
  • Share of population that are seniors: 15.8%

13. San Francisco-Oakland-Hayward, CA

  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(adjusted): $61,753
  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(actual): $74,000
  • Median annual wage for all full-time workers (adjusted): $71,767
  • Share of full-time workforce that are seniors: 4.4%
  • Share of population that are seniors: 16.7%

12. Baltimore-Columbia-Towson, MD

  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(adjusted): $61,898
  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(actual): $65,000
  • Median annual wage for all full-time workers (adjusted): $61,898
  • Share of full-time workforce that are seniors: 5.2%
  • Share of population that are seniors: 16.2%

11. Providence-Warwick, RI-MA

  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(adjusted): $62,254
  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(actual): $63,000
  • Median annual wage for all full-time workers (adjusted): $59,289
  • Share of full-time workforce that are seniors: 5.1%
  • Share of population that are seniors: 18.1%

10. Milwaukee-Waukesha-West Allis, WI

  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(adjusted): $62,752
  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(actual): $60,000
  • Median annual wage for all full-time workers (adjusted): $57,523
  • Share of full-time workforce that are seniors: 3.4%
  • Share of population that are seniors: 16.7%

9. Nashville-Davidson–Murfreesboro–Franklin, TN

  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(adjusted): $62,807
  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(actual): $60,000
  • Median annual wage for all full-time workers (adjusted): $52,339
  • Share of full-time workforce that are seniors: 4.0%
  • Share of population that are seniors: 14.3%

8. Buffalo-Cheektowaga-Niagara Falls, NY

  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(adjusted): $63,084
  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(actual): $60,000
  • Median annual wage for all full-time workers (adjusted): $56,775
  • Share of full-time workforce that are seniors: 4.1%
  • Share of population that are seniors: 19.0%

7. San Jose-Sunnyvale-Santa Clara, CA

  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(adjusted): $64,491
  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(actual): $72,000
  • Median annual wage for all full-time workers (adjusted): $89,570
  • Share of full-time workforce that are seniors: 4.1%
  • Share of population that are seniors: 14.5%

6. Tucson, AZ

  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(adjusted): $64,570
  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(actual): $60,000
  • Median annual wage for all full-time workers (adjusted): $51,656
  • Share of full-time workforce that are seniors: 4.6%
  • Share of population that are seniors: 20.6%

5. San Diego-Carlsbad, CA

  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(adjusted): $65,133
  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(actual): $75,000
  • Median annual wage for all full-time workers (adjusted): $52,106
  • Share of full-time workforce that are seniors: 3.9%
  • Share of population that are seniors: 14.9%

4. Philadelphia-Camden-Wilmington, PA-NJ-DE-MD

  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(adjusted): $65,518
  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(actual): $65,000
  • Median annual wage for all full-time workers (adjusted): $62,494
  • Share of full-time workforce that are seniors: 5.1%
  • Share of population that are seniors: 16.8%

3. Boston-Cambridge-Newton, MA-NH

  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(adjusted): $70,198
  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(actual): $77,000
  • Median annual wage for all full-time workers (adjusted): $68,375
  • Share of full-time workforce that are seniors: 4.8%
  • Share of population that are seniors: 16.5%

2. Hartford-West Hartford-East Hartford, CT

  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(adjusted): $70,788
  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(actual): $72,000
  • Median annual wage for all full-time workers (adjusted): $63,906
  • Share of full-time workforce that are seniors: 4.9%
  • Share of population that are seniors: 18.3%

1. Washington-Arlington-Alexandria, DC-VA-MD-WV

  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(adjusted): $73,649
  • Median annual wage for full-time seniors (actual): $82,000
  • Median annual wage for all full-time workers (adjusted): $70,056
  • Share of full-time workforce that are seniors: 4.8%
  • Share of population that are seniors: 13.9%

Methodology

The data used in this analysis is from the U.S. Census Bureau’s 2021 American Community Survey.

To determine the best-paying locations for working seniors, researchers at Smartest Dollar calculated the cost-of-living adjusted median annual wage for seniors working full-time.

In the event of a tie, the location with the greater unadjusted median annual wage for seniors working full-time was ranked higher. For the purposes of this analysis, seniors were considered to be ages 65 and older.
